Ukraine enters world's top five poultry suppliers

Ukraine ranked fourth, following Brazil, the European Union, and Thailand.

Ukrainian Minister of Economic Development, Trade and Agriculture Tymofiy Mylovanov has announced that Ukraine entered the world's Top 5 countries in terms of poultry meat exports, as well as received permission from the European Union to export 58,000 tonnes of wheat to the EU countries.

"[Our] victories in agriculture. Firstly, Ukraine entered the world's Top 5 exporters of poultry, following Brazil, the European Union, and Thailand. Secondly, the EU issued permits to buy 58,000 tonnes of Ukrainian wheat as part of the first distribution of the tariff rate quota (TRQ) for 2020. Almost the entire quota was issued for duty-free shipments of Ukrainian wheat," he wrote on Facebook on January 14.

As UNIAN reported earlier, the Verkhovna Rada, Ukraine's parliament, ratified the EU-Ukraine agreement to boost quotas for duty-free poultry exports from Ukraine, up to 70,000 tonnes by 2021.
